People attend a Public Service Alliance of Canada (PSAC) rally in ... Web18 Oct 2012 · 9. Attach relevant documents. Attach any handouts or materials electronically, so that all participants and non-participants have easy access to them. This is helpful for individuals who missed the meeting or if people need to get a brief reminder of what was covered. 10. Ask a question when distributing the minutes.

WebMinutes of a school governing body must be signed off to show they have been approved by governors or trustees as an accurate record of the meeting. In a meeting of the full … WebMinutes are simply notes taken during the meeting to remind you what was discussed and agreed. They don’t need to be long or complicated, in fancy language or perfect grammar. … WebThe minutes of a meeting belong to the people at that meeting. Preparing them is a service to the meeting. WebIf you see someone showing signs of anger or frustration, consider setting aside time in your meeting for a brief questioning session to reduce any tension before it leads to conflict. Remove or Reduce the Perceived Threat A key cause of anger or conflict is that people may perceive that they, or things they hold dear, are threatened.
